The Java Portlet Specification is an APIs specification for the Java Enterprise Platform to enable interoperability between Java portlets and Web portals. This specification defines a set of APIs for portal computing that address the areas of aggregation, personalization, presentation, and security. The portlet specification was developed under the Java Community Process as JSR 168.
